André Bargull ee78515033 Bug 1719733 - Part 1: Add a MeasureUnit class to the unified Intl API. r=platform-i18n-reviewers,dminor
Currently only provides a single method to retrieve all available measurement units.

`MeasureUnit::GetAvailable()` returns an enumeration similar to the other Intl
classes which use `intl::Enumeration`. This approach gives us a more consistent
API, because it abstracts away the internal ICU implementation, which looks up
the measurement units through `UResourceBundle`. But it also means the
implementation is slightly more complicated due to this additional abstraction.

The default constructor was deleted because all methods are static.

#include "gtest/gtest.h"
#include "mozilla/intl/MeasureUnit.h"
#include "mozilla/Span.h"
namespace mozilla::intl {
TEST(IntlMeasureUnit, GetAvailable)
{
auto units = MeasureUnit::GetAvailable();
ASSERT_TRUE(units.isOk());
// Test a subset of the installed measurement units.
auto gigabyte = MakeStringSpan("gigabyte");
auto liter = MakeStringSpan("liter");
auto meter = MakeStringSpan("meter");
auto meters = MakeStringSpan("meters"); // Plural "meters" is invalid.
bool hasGigabyte = false;
bool hasLiter = false;
bool hasMeter = false;
bool hasMeters = false;
for (auto unit : units.unwrap()) {
ASSERT_TRUE(unit.isOk());
auto span = unit.unwrap();
hasGigabyte |= span == gigabyte;
hasLiter |= span == liter;
hasMeter |= span == meter;
hasMeters |= span == meters;
}
ASSERT_TRUE(hasGigabyte);
ASSERT_TRUE(hasLiter);
ASSERT_TRUE(hasMeter);
ASSERT_FALSE(hasMeters);
}
} // namespace mozilla::intl
